How they compare
Tanzania currently reports 231.54 2010 = 100 against 231.51 2010 = 100 in Tunisia, a difference of 0.03 2010 = 100.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 43 shared years of data; in 1983 it was Tunisia ahead.
Tanzania ranks 46th and Tunisia ranks 47th of 190 countries.
Across the 5 decades both report, Tanzania averaged higher in 2 and Tunisia in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Tanzania | Tunisia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 3.29 2010 = 100 | 36.38 2010 = 100 | 33.09 2010 = 100 | Tunisia |
| 1990s | 26.92 2010 = 100 | 60.81 2010 = 100 | 33.89 2010 = 100 | Tunisia |
| 2000s | 67.85 2010 = 100 | 83.97 2010 = 100 | 16.12 2010 = 100 | Tunisia |
| 2010s | 150.19 2010 = 100 | 123.36 2010 = 100 | 26.84 2010 = 100 | Tanzania |
| 2020s | 212.81 2010 = 100 | 197.07 2010 = 100 | 15.74 2010 = 100 | Tanzania |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
